    The Ultimate Guide to Choosing the Perfect Uzi MAC-11 Airsoft Replica for Your Tactical Game

    John CoheeBy John CoheeFebruary 20, 2025Updated:June 20, 2025No Comments3 Mins Read
    Facebook Twitter Pinterest LinkedIn Tumblr Email
    Share
    Facebook Twitter LinkedIn Pinterest Email

    When it comes to close-quarters combat in airsoft, compact firepower makes all the difference. Among the most iconic submachine guns in the airsoft world, the Uzi and MAC-11 replicas stand out for their sleek design, high rate of fire, and battlefield versatility. Whether you’re a beginner looking to step up your CQB (Close Quarters Battle) game or a seasoned player building a secondary loadout, this guide will help you choose the perfect Uzi MAC-11 replicas to dominate your next match.

    Why Choose a Uzi or MAC-11 Airsoft Replica?

    These compact SMGs are inspired by legendary real-steel designs used in military and law enforcement operations around the world. Here’s why they’re popular in airsoft:

    • Compact and Lightweight – Ideal for tight spaces and fast movements.
    • High Rate of Fire – Perfect for suppressive fire and fast takedowns.
    • Unique Aesthetics – Stand out with these retro-futuristic designs.
    • Great Backup or Primary for CQB – Easy to carry as a secondary or even use as your main in CQB environments.

    Key Features to Consider

    When shopping for the perfect Uzi or MAC-11 airsoft replica, consider the following aspects to match your playstyle and performance needs:

    1. Power Source: AEP, GBB, or CO2
    • AEP (Automatic Electric Pistol): Offers consistency and affordability, especially in colder climates.
    • GBB (Gas Blowback): Delivers realism with recoil and sound—great for immersion.
    • CO2-Powered: Strong kick and performance, but may require more maintenance and can be louder.

    Pro Tip: For CQB scenarios, GBB models offer quick bursts and realistic handling, while AEPs provide steady performance.

    1. FPS and ROF (Rate of Fire)

    Look for replicas with a muzzle velocity suitable for indoor play (typically under 350 FPS). ROF is key in close-quarters—higher ROF can give you the edge in room-clearing engagements.

    1. Magazine Capacity

    Uzi and MAC-11 replicas typically use:

    • Standard mags (20–30 rounds) for realism
    • Extended or drum mags (up to 100+ rounds) for sustained engagements

    Ensure your magazine setup supports your playstyle—high-capacity magazines for aggressive play or low- to mid-capacity magazines for realistic military simulation (mil-sim).

    1. Build Quality and Materials
    • Polymer Models – Lightweight and affordable, suitable for fast-paced CQB.
    • Full Metal Models – Offer durability and authentic feel, but add extra weight.
    1. Upgrade and Accessory Compatibility

    Some models allow for rail attachments (lasers, optics, flashlights). Choose a replica with customization options for tactical flexibility.

    Top Uzi & MAC-11 Replicas to Consider

    1. KWC MAC-11 CO2 Blowback
      • Full-auto fire
      • Impressive ROF and realistic blowback
      • Excellent for fast-paced indoor games
    2. Tokyo Marui MAC-11 AEP
      • Great entry-level option
      • Reliable, quiet, and consistent
      • Battery-powered—ideal for colder weather
    3. Umarex Uzi GBB
      • Licensed design with an iconic look
      • Blowback system with satisfying recoil
      • Realistic weight and metal construction
    4. CYMA MAC-11 AEP
      • Budget-friendly and beginner-friendly
      • It has a good rate of fire and is easy to maintain

    Tactical Loadout Tips

    Pair your Uzi or MAC-11 with:

    • A chest rig or drop leg mag pouch for quick reloads
    • A reliable secondary (like a gas pistol) if using it as a primary
    • Tactical gloves and a lightweight helmet for mobility
    • A mock suppressor or foregrip (if your replica supports attachments)
